WebDec 31, 2024 · Structured bonus programs reached record-high funding levels this year and are projected to do the same in 2024, says Ken Abosch, an employee rewards consulting leader at Aon, a global consulting firm. On average, he says, companies in 2024 are planning to budget 13.1% of payroll for bonus expenses, up from 12.9% in 2024 and 12.5% in 2024. WebJun 20, 2024 · An incentive plan should include all of the following points: The goal that must be met to earn the incentive. What constitutes successfully reaching that goal – this must be concrete, detailed and clear. The reward earned for reaching the goal. How the reward is disbursed to qualifying employees.
